蚂蚁金服作为全球领先的金融科技公司,其在前端框架领域的创新和领先地位备受瞩目。本文将深入剖析蚂蚁金服在前端框架重构过程中的成功秘诀,揭示其如何引领前端框架新潮流。
一、背景介绍
随着互联网技术的飞速发展,前端框架在提升用户体验、提高开发效率方面发挥着越来越重要的作用。蚂蚁金服作为金融科技领域的佼佼者,其前端框架的优化与创新对整个行业具有深远影响。
二、重构目标
蚂蚁金服前端框架重构的目标主要包括以下几点:
- 提升性能:优化加载速度、响应速度,提升用户体验。
- 增强可维护性:简化代码结构,提高代码可读性和可维护性。
- 提高可扩展性:支持更多业务场景,满足不同团队的开发需求。
- 降低开发成本:简化开发流程,降低人力成本。
三、重构策略
1. 技术选型
蚂蚁金服在重构前端框架时,充分考虑了以下技术选型:
- 框架选择:基于React、Vue等主流前端框架,结合自身业务特点进行定制化开发。
- 构建工具:使用Webpack、Rollup等现代化构建工具,提高开发效率和性能。
2. 代码重构
- 模块化:将代码拆分成多个模块,提高代码复用性和可维护性。
- 组件化:将页面拆分成多个组件,实现页面复用和组件化开发。
- 优化算法:针对性能瓶颈,优化算法,提高页面加载速度和响应速度。
3. 工具链优化
- 代码审查:建立完善的代码审查机制,确保代码质量。
- 持续集成:采用Git、Jenkins等工具,实现自动化测试和部署。
- 性能监控:使用Lighthouse、WebPageTest等工具,实时监控页面性能。
四、成功案例
1. 蚂蚁金服移动端App
通过重构前端框架,蚂蚁金服移动端App在性能、可维护性和可扩展性方面取得了显著提升。以下是一些具体案例:
- 性能优化:通过优化算法和代码,App启动速度提升了30%。
- 可维护性提升:代码结构更加清晰,可读性提高,维护成本降低。
- 可扩展性增强:支持更多业务场景,满足不同团队的开发需求。
2. 蚂蚁金服官网
重构后的蚂蚁金服官网在用户体验、性能和可维护性方面得到了显著提升。以下是一些具体案例:
- 用户体验:页面加载速度提升了40%,响应速度更快。
- 性能优化:通过优化算法和代码,页面加载速度提升了30%。
- 可维护性提升:代码结构更加清晰,可读性提高,维护成本降低。
五、总结
蚂蚁金服在前端框架重构过程中,通过技术选型、代码重构和工具链优化等策略,成功实现了性能、可维护性和可扩展性的提升。这些成功经验为其他企业和开发者提供了有益的借鉴,引领了前端框架新潮流。